Top Dogs with the Strongest Bite Force
dogs with the strongest bite in the
world we have been breeding dogs for
thousands of years all over the world
for many different reasons dogs are now
the number one chosen pet across the
world but there are dangers that come
with owning certain dog breeds depending
on why we’ve bred them some breeds are
famed for their soft mouth when they are
able to retrieve game gently and without
harming it whereas some are famed for
their strong bite dogs you wouldn’t want
to get on the wrong side of we can
measure a dog’s bite scientifically by
measuring the bite in pound per square
inch psi which tells you how much
pressure is exerted on one square inch
for example a crocodile’s psi is over
5,000 whereas a human’s is only around
120 to 140 as we’re talking about dogs
today the average psi for our canine
friends is 220 to 240 psi however the
dogs we’re going to be looking at today
are way above that figure the size of
your dog will have an impact on how
strong their bite is usually a small dog
will not have as large a bite force as a
dog with a large square head so without
further ado let’s look at the eight dogs
with the strongest Abidin eight German
Shepherd 238 psi German Shepherds are
now the most popular dog breed to have
as a pet across the whole world they are
also the most widely used in police
forces and the military across the globe
this is thanks to their great trained
ability but also fearless and protective
nature that along with a psi of 238
means that any criminal or thief would
think twice about doing anything wrong
originally bred as guard dogs German
Shepherds are now often trained in the
police to tactically take down criminals
that are running away their trainer
wears a special sleeve to avoid injury
while training them to bite the forearm
of the assailant although the German
Shepherd is eighth on our list its bite
can not only pierce skin it can also
break bones
so it’s by no means weak in comparison
to the other dogs on our list it makes
up for its bite force score with
ferociousness seven Doberman 245 psi
slightly higher than the German Shepherd
here in seventh place we have the
Doberman originally bred as the ideal
guard and protection dog it’s no wonder
that Doberman has a strong bite force
with their large square head and capable
jaw muscles they can break a man’s arm
in one bite that paired with being
territorial aggressive and energetic
make them perfect guard dogs as who’d
want to mess with one of these there has
been some debate over whether 245 psi is
a high enough ranking for the Doberman
as some dogs have had a score between
200 to 400 psi but it’s also claimed
those dogs were specifically trained so
the averages aren’t considered six
American Bulldog 305 psi in at number
six is the American Bulldog it’s often
confused with a pitbull due to their
stocky bodies similarly shaped heads and
mouths but they are a completely
different breed the American Bulldog
stands a little taller and has more
pointed ears but both were bred for a
similar purpose
this breed was originally a
working-class dog
taken by immigrants to the American
South the dog was taken with travellers
to offer protection on the road and in
new lands their bite is an impressive
305 psi for their size as they are
somewhat smaller than the other dogs on
our list at least in length their head
and mouth are the typical square set
that makes a strong bite the American
Bulldog bonds strongly with its owner
and will do anything to protect it this
along with its strong bite force makes
it a challenge for anyone picking a
fight with his owner 5 African wild dog
317 psi in fifth place we have the
African wild dog a relative of the
sub-saharan dog which means it’s both an
expert hunter but also relatively small
compared to the other dogs on the
list although the largest in its family
this read is still only a medium-sized
dog what he doesn’t have in brawn he
more than makes up for in bite this
breed is known to be hyper carnivorous
this means that over 70% of their diet
is made up of meat so they need a strong
powerful jaw to take down and make quick
work of their dinner in the wild their
favorite prey is the antelope a big deer
like animal that can run very fast
luckily due to the African wild dogs
slim frame he can easily catch up to an
antelope and thanks to his bite force he
can break any bone in a deer with a
single bite 4 Rottweiler 328 psi
Rottweilers were one of the first breeds
to be adopted by the police and army as
an attack dog due to their size and
brute strength although they were
originally bred to pull carts they were
also trained to be impressive guard dogs
as their weighty body along with their
sharp strong teeth made a match for
anyone trying to break in nowadays
they’re used more in search and rescue
operations in the police as well as
guard dogs in the home although they
have a powerful bite force lots of
people find Rottweilers friendly and
great family pets due to their happy
nature and eagerness to please 3 wolf
dog 406 psi in third place we have the
powerful bite of the wolf dog I wouldn’t
recommend having one of these as a pet
as the hybrid of wolf and dog can be a
little Wilder and therefore more
dangerous than another breed humans may
have been breeding wolves and
domesticated dogs for centuries the
first mention of the concept was 10,000
years ago originally it’s thought they
were bred for their aggression and wild
temper that made them excellent attack
dogs in battle that along with their
strong bite makes them a force to be
reckoned with
however people that breed these dogs do
find that due to a strong pack mentality
they can be trained to be less hostile
and make good guard dogs
two English Mastiff 556 psi Mastiffs are
known as a breed group with one of if
not the strongest bite in the world
because of their large head and super
powerful jaw they have an average psi of
over 500 however the Mastiff breed is
not known for its aggression and they
would far prefer to cozy up on the couch
with you rather than be outside guarding
the house despite their super strong
bite they rarely attack unless they feel
their human needs protection and as such
they are very good with children
however they need training to make sure
they aren’t destructive when left alone
in the house that strong jaw and playful
attitude can mean your pillows sofa and
even table could be in trouble if you’re
not careful one Kongo 743 psi in at
number one with an incredible score of
743 is the Congo originally bred to
guard land from animal attackers in
Turkey the Congo size and protective
streak make it the strongest and most
powerful dog on our list this dog has a
PSI score similar to a wolf and as such
can guard livestock as well as people
from wild invaders it can take down a
medium-sized predator in minutes and
it’s fearlessness alongside the bite
force of an incredible 743 make it a
match for anything these have been our
